Choosing the Right Tone: Romantic, Funny, or Sentimental?
Pick a tone that matches your relationship and how you express love. Consider your shared memories and inside jokes. Your message should feel genuine and authentic.
- Romantic: If you’ve had a lot of heartfelt moments, choose a romantic tone. Focus on the deep connection you share. Compliment your boyfriend’s personality and your journey together. A few sincere words about his impact on your life will show how much you care.
- Funny: If humor is a big part of your relationship, go for a light-hearted, funny tone. Recall amusing moments or inside jokes that make him laugh. A playful tone can make the message feel relaxed and personal. It’s a great way to show that you enjoy each other’s company and don’t take life too seriously.
- Sentimental: If your relationship is marked by moments of tenderness and thoughtfulness, a sentimental tone works well. Reflect on shared memories or how he’s helped you grow. Express appreciation for the little things he does and the love you’ve built together.
Keep the tone consistent with how you interact daily. Let your message feel like an extension of your natural relationship dynamics.
